
1950
Foundation of the company Polymer Synthese Werk Rudolf Klaus &Co. KG by Rudolf Klaus in Mülheim/Ruhr. A technical production plant with completely new manufacturing processes had to be planned and built to process the raw material "polyethylene" that was available at the time. With the construction of the plant, new paths had to be explored. Since work was being done in a still unknown production area, setbacks were inevitable. But thanks to Rudolf Klaus' many years of industrial experience as an employee in large chemical plants, the hard work on the construction led to success. Not only did industrial processes for the production of the raw materials have to be developed, but also the machines for the film production. Consequently, new machines were designed and built in collaboration with the chemical, mechanical and electrical industries.
